English
Language : 

AK4650 Datasheet, PDF (64/86 Pages) Asahi Kasei Microsystems – 16Bit ΔΣ CODEC with MIC/HP/SPK-AMP & TSC
[AK4650]
Table 54 shows the relationship of bit 14&13 and the Read/Write operation.
Bit 15
Valid Frame
1
1
1
1
Bit 14: Slot1 Valid Bit Bit 13: Slot 2 Valid Bit
(Command Address)
(Command Data)
Read/Write Operation
1
1
Read/Write (Normal Operation)
0
1
Ignore
1
0
Read: Normal Operation
Write: Ignore
0
0
Ignore
Table 54. AK4650 Addressing: Slot 0 Tag Bits
[Slot 1]: Command Address Port
Slot1 gives the address of the command data, which is given in the slot 2. The AK4650 has 30 valid registers of 16bit data.
See “Mixer Registers”.
BITCLK
SDATAOUT
Slot 0
Bit19 Bit18 Bit17 Bit16 Bit15 Bit14 Bit13 Bit12 Bit11 Bit10 Bit9
“1/0” “1/0” “1/0” “1/0” “1/0” “1/0” “1/0” “1/0” “0” “0” “0”
Slot 1
Command Address Port
Bit2 Bit1 Bit0
“0” “0” “0”
Bit19 Bit18 Bit17 Bit1
6
Slot 2
Figure 49. Slot 1
Bit 19:
Read/Write command (1bit; “1”=read, “0”=write)
Bit 18-12: Control Register Index (7bit; see “Mixer Registers” for the detail)
Bit 11-0: Reserved (12bit; “0”)
Bit 18 of this slot 1 is equivalent to the most significant bit of the index register address.
The AK4650 ignores bit 11-0. These bits will be reserved for future enhancement and must be stuffed with “0” by the
AC’97 controller.
[Slot 2]: Command Data Port
BITCLK
SDATAOUT
Slot 1
Bit19 Bit18 Bit17 Bit16 Bit15 Bit14 Bit13 Bit12 Bit6 Bit5 Bit4 Bit3 Bit2 Bit1 Bit0 Bit19 Bit18 Bit17 Bit16
“1/0” “1/0” “1/0” “1/0” “1/0” “1/0” “1/0” “1/0”
Slot 2
Command Data Port
“1/0” “1/0” “0” “0” “0” “0”
Slot 3
Figure 50. Slot 2
Bit19-4:
Bit3-0:
Control Register Write Data (16bit)
(If bit 19 of slot 1 is “1”, all bit19-4 should be “0”.)
Reserved (4bit; “0”)
If bit 19 in slot 1 is “0”, the AC’97 controller must output Command Data Port data in slot 2 of the same frame. If the
bit 19 in slot 1 is “1”, the AK4650 will ignore any Command Data Port data in slot 2.
Bit19 of this slot 2 is equivalent to D15 bit of mixer register value.
MS0502-E-01
- 64 -
2007/04